I am presently using a 6" x 1/8" packed column and want to put in
a 6' x 1/4" column. Is there a specific adapter I need to make this change? Thanks :roll:
Many injection ports are 1/4" OD. To use a 1/4" OD column you merely use 1/4" graphite ferrules and nuts to install.

On the detector side it depends upon which detector you are using.

The easiest path to determining how and if you can use 1/4"OD columns is to read the manual that came with the GC or to contact the GC vendor sales representative.

One can use 1/8" to 1/4" reducing unions from Swagelock or someother vendor but that may not be advisable depending on the samples upon which you perform analyses.
